About This Home
This property must be seen to be appreciated. This 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om brick home has hardwood floors and ceramic tile in the kitchen, bathrooms, and laundry room. The open floor plan includes new cabinets and appliances in the kitchen with a bar and an eat-in area which opens off to a bonus/playroom. With a large yard in front and back there is plenty of room for children to play and lots of room for parking. Check out a key today before it is too late!

Nestled in the foothills of the Appalachian Mountains, Rome is Georgia’s premier city for history, natural beauty, and a lively community. This riverfront town is located about 70 miles northwest of Atlanta and less than 20 miles east of the Alabama state line. Rome offers residents a blend of rural seclusion, scenic views, and a vibrant urban oasis.
Rome cultivates a local culture rich with history, the arts, and stunning architecture throughout town. The city houses four colleges, collectively serving thousands of students and contributing major cultural and intellectual capital to Rome. This tight-knit community enjoys special events throughout the year, from the annual Rome International Film Festival to the Rome Shakespeare Festival. Downtown Rome features a top-notch selection of local restaurants, historic sites, specialty shops, and riverfront views.
Rentals in Rome are surprisingly affordable, ranging from upgraded apartments to cozy single-family homes.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
